Output ece8b109488c319298d8c323b884f80df61df04c25605ac4a47409ea344741e8:26

value
988493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 160577ab25f5c12ebd3fefa0117087babc0abe86 OP_EQUAL
address
33hTLed5yGV1fUzBguXVxBady7KusSsHhC
transaction
ece8b109488c319298d8c323b884f80df61df04c25605ac4a47409ea344741e8
spent
true